Oh and Shannon speaking French? At first I didn't fully understand what she said, but I got the words "la mer, des reflets changeants", which made me thought of the song "la mer" straight away, as I learnt it in school when I was 9! And the written words confirmed that. The English lyrics of "Beyond the sea" are quite different because it's mo are about love and the French ones are more about the sea itself. I love this song. Because it was sung by three of my favorite celebrities : Billy Boyd (video on his website!), Ewan McGregor ("A life less ordinary") and Robbie Williams (on his album "Swing when you're winning" but also in this "fish movie" LOL).
